Powerful processor: The CPUs achieve instruction execution times as low as 0.03 µs per binary instruction.
CPU 416-2: 5.6 MB RAM (of which 2.8 MB each for program and data); CPU 416-3: 11.2 MB RAM (of which 5.6 MB each for program and data); CPU 416-3 PN/DP: 16 MB RAM (of which 8 MB each for program and data); fast RAM for parts of the user program relevant to execution.
Flexible expansion: Up to 262144 digital and 16384 analog inputs/outputs.
Multi-point interface MPI: With the MPI it is possible to establish simple networking of max. 32 stations at a data transmission rate of up to 12 Mbit/s. The CPUs can establish up to 44 connections to stations of the communications bus (C bus) and the MPI.
Mode selector switch: Designed as toggle switch.
Diagnostics buffer: The last 120 fault and interrupt events are retained in a ring buffer for diagnostic purposes. The number of entries can be parameterized.
Real-time clock: The date and time are appended to diagnostic messages of the CPU.
Memory card: For expansion of the integrated load memory. RAM and FEPROM cards (FEPROM for retentive storage) are available.
Combined MPI/DP interface and integrated PROFIBUS DP interface (CPU 416-2 and CPU 416-3): The PROFIBUS DP master interface allows a distributed automation configuration offering high speed and ease of use. From the user's point of view, the distributed I/O is treated as central I/O (same configuring, addressing and programming). Mixed configuration: SIMATIC S5 and SIMATIC S7 as PROFIBUS master according to EN 50170.
CPU 416-3 and CPU 416-3 PN/DP also include:
A module slot: An additional PROFIBUS DP master system can be connected via the IF 964-DP interface module.
